			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>I&#039;ve completed and submitted my article on <a href="http://www.freebsd.org/doc/en/articles/nanobsd/index.html">NanoBSD</a>, the &#034;miniature&#034; <a href="http://www.freebsd.org/">FreeBSD</a>. At 3000+ words, turned out a bit longer than I had expected, so I hope they won&#039;t chop too much of it.</p>
<p>NanoBSD works wonders on <a href="http://www.pcengines.ch/">PC Engines</a>&#039;  <a href="http://www.pcengines.ch/alix.htm">ALIX</a> series of boards, so I&#039;ve used some of those as examples for NanoBSD usage. I contacted PC Engines for permission to use one of their photos, and Pascal Dornier, founder of PC Engines, went a step further and shot some custom photos of their equipment for me. Much appreciated.</p>
